How to Determine What Disk Brake Kit will Fit a 1994 EZ Loader Boat Trailer  

Question:

Have a 1994 ezloader trailer for a bass boat . tandem axle with drum brakes. Already bought the slide in brake acuater? with the white wire for reverse. Not sure what kit to buy. I believe I have 10 drums existing. sorry for grammer. thanks

Expert Reply:

To determine what disk brake kit you would need to convert your current drum brakes to disk you need to first determine what spindle you have on your trailer so that you can match the correct rotor/hubs to fit them.

If you pull the hubs off of your trailer and get the bearing numbers (inner and outer) and they happen to be L68149 for inner and L44649 for outer this kit # K2HR35D would fit and work well for you.

You will need to make sure that the brake actuator you have has been confirmed to work with disk brakes as some only can be used with drums.

Next thing you will need to know is the bolt pattern of your hubs. This is so you get a hub that is compatible with your wheels. I attached an FAQ article on determining bolt pattern for you to check out. This kit has a 5 on 4-1/2 bolt pattern.
